Stāsta arhitekte Dace Kalvāne Tas, ka Latvijas Radio ēka savulaik bija Rīgas Komercbanka, bet vēlāk – Latvijas Kredītbanka, droši vien ir zināms daudziem. Ēku projektēja ebreju izcelsmes arhitekts Pauls Mandelštams. 1926. gadā būve tika pilnībā pabeigta un nodota bankas vajadzībām. Prestižā ēka blīvajā Vecrīgas apbūvē pirms II Pasaules kara nebija vizuāli tik labi uztverama, kā tas ir šodien. Doma laukuma "atbrīvošana no apbūves" notika galvenokārt 1936. un 1937. gadā ar mērķi radīt plašāku laukumu ap Doma baznīcu, uzsvērt baznīcas monumentalitāti un sakārtot pilsētvidi, kā arī izveidot vecpilsētā autoritatīvā Ulmaņa režīma urbāno "vitrini" – vietu svinībām, mītiņiem un politiskai simbolikai. Pilsētvides pārveides rezultātā Komercbankas ēkas fasāde daudz labāk tika eksponēta atvērtajā pilsēttelpā, kur virs eksedras labi nolasāmas tēlnieka Augusta Folca skulptūras, kas simbolizē pārticību un labklājību, kā arī Rīgas ģerbonis. Arhitekta Mandelštama 1913. gada sākotnējais Komercbankas nama plānojums bija apbrīnojami mūsdienīgs – ar plašu bankas operāciju telpu kā divstāvu ātriju ar stiklotu virsgaismu, brīva plānojuma, apbpusēji labi izgaismotām darba vietām, optimāli izvietotām vertikālajām komunikācijām – gan kāpnēm, gan liftiem. Arī inženiertehniskajā ziņā sākotnējais projekts bija ļoti mūsdienīgs ar gaisa ieņemšanu apzaļumotajā iekšpagalmā un gaisa kanālu pa ēkas perimetru pagraba līmenī. Sniega novadīšanai no stiklotās ātrija virsgaismas uz iekšpagalmu, bija izbūvēta speciāla sistēma. Komercbankas vajadzībām divos pagraba līmeņos bija izbūvēts seifs, kuram drošības dēļ bija izveidotas dubultās sienas. Pēc II Pasaules kara 1946. gada 24. maijā tika pieņemts lēmums ēku pārbūvēt par Radionamu. Topošā Radionama pārbūves darbā tika iesaistīti vācu armijas gūstekņi, kas plēsa un kala milzīgās seifu sienas, bet rūpnīcas "Radiotehnika" strādnieki saražoja jaunas raidāmās ierīces, un 1948. gada novembrī jaunā koncertstudija bija gatava. Tā aizņem daļu no bijušās Latvijas Kredītbankas milzīgās kases operāciju zāles. Studijas sienas bija veidotas no liekta ozola finiera, aiz kura bija gumija, stikla vate, gaisa kārta, gāzbetons un divas mūra ķieģeļu kārtas, kas pasargāja telpu no ārpasaules trokšņiem. Gaišo, eleganto interjeru nomainīja slēgtas sienas ar liektajiem akustiskajiem paneļiem, stikloto virsgaismu aizvietoja ar dekoratīvajām griestu kasetēm, kur tika iestrādāti dekoratīvie ornamenti – zvaigzne (8 gab.), kokle (4 gab.), lira (4 gab) un saule (2 gab). Līdzīga tematika lietota cokolstāva griestu dekoratīvajā apdarē, bet kafejnīcas pārbūves laikā atklājās, ka padomju laikā kolonnu korintiskajos kapiteļos bija iestrādātas zvaigznes kādreizējo ziedu vietā. No sākotnējā bankas interjera ir saglabājušās majestātiskās betona kāpnes, kas reiz veda uz plašo bankas operāciju zāli, un vestibila lēzenais kupols. Taču bijušās Komercbankas ēkas atvērtā plānojuma darbinieku telpas tika sadalītas atsevišķos kabinetos un apkārt kādreizējam ātrijam tika izveidotas ierakstu studijas. 1949. gada 5. novembrī Latvijas Radio oficiāli sāka pilnvērtīgu darbību šajā namā. Pēdējos gados atsevišķu Latvijas Radio telpu pārbūves gaitā atklājušās vairākas interesantas nianses. Modernizējot gaisa apmaiņas sistēmu ieraksta studijā, padomju laika vēdināšanas kanālā tika atrasts vācu karagūstekņa ieraksts, kuru 1948. gada 28. septembrī rakstījis Otto Brathering - runa ir par to, ka gūsts ilgst vēl tikai 84 dienas... Pagājušā gada janvārī Latvijas Radio namā remontdarbu rezultātā sāka gruzdēt vate, kas radīja piedūmojumu. Darbiniekus evakuēja, un izrādījās, ka, veicot būvdarbus vienā no ierakstu studijām, sakarsušais urbis izraisījis akustisko paneļu pildījuma gruzdēšanu. Atsedzot akustiskos paneļus, izrādījās, ka akustiskais pildījums bija marlē ietīta vate... Pēdējo gadu pārbūvju rezultātā Latvijas Radio telpās pamazām tiek atjaunoti brīvā plānojuma biroji, restaurēti logi Doma laukuma fasādē arhitektoniski vērtīgās durvis. Latvijas Radio ir simbols 100 gadu raidīšanas vēsturei, bet pati ēka savu simtgadi svinēs pēc gada.
Prestižno priznanje si bodo razdelili Američana Mary Brunkow in Fred Ramsdell ter Japonec Shimon Sakaguchi.Prvi ponedeljek v oktobru že tradicionalno požlahtnijo Nobelove nagrade za najboljše znanstvene dosežke. Danes dopoldan so tako v Stockholmu razglasili letošnje nagrajence za področje medicine in fiziologije. Prestižno priznanje si bodo razdelili Američana Mary Brunkow in Fred Ramsdell ter Japonec Shimon Sakaguchi za raziskave na področju imunologije. Odkrili so, kako imunski sistem prepreči, da bi obrambne celice organizma napadle snovi, ki telesu niso nevarne. Razglasitev je spremljal Iztok Konc, razlaga imunolog Alojz Ihan. durée : 00:04:43 - Étude n°7 de la guitariste Ida Presti (1924-1967) - "Ida Presti a écrit entre autres les 6 Études, commande des Éditions Max Eschig. Le manuscrit original des 6 Études en contenait en fait 7. Une avait donc été écartée du cycle, et récemment son brouillon a été retrouvé, celle-ci révisée est republiée aux Éditions Habanera."
